Output 2998237fc109f4ddc29617f2aa22761c0c21352f74e13a81b05b109a23c41f48:76

value
36998
script pubkey
OP_0 OP_PUSHBYTES_20 2f4ec498c43389187360d54364e441dcb8903e55
address
bc1q9a8vfxxyxwy3sumq64pkfezpmjufq0j4zv3tck
transaction
2998237fc109f4ddc29617f2aa22761c0c21352f74e13a81b05b109a23c41f48